Transmission and Distribution (T&D)
We have a tremendously challenging programme in front of us in the run up to achieving 2030 net zero targets. New overhead lines, underground cables, substations, battery storage and subsea links are all needed – and quickly. AECOM Transmission and Distribution is currently supporting the network development which will underpin grid modernisation. Working to modernise the UK’s Energy Infrastructure
AECOM has been recently appointed to provide design and consenting services for the UK\’s National Grid’s Great Grid Program, in a joint venture with Arup. This £9bn initiative aims to enhance the electricity transmission network, ensuring the integration of renewable energy sources, including offshore wind farms, into the grid by 2030, which will also support future projects beyond 2030. The project focuses on upgrading infrastructure to meet future energy demands, reduce fossil fuel dependency, and support the UK\’s net zero emissions target.
